CarGurus Header
Location:

Include delivery listings?

Used Subaru for Sale Under $40,000 Near Wayzata, MN

2,011 results

Year:
2019
Make:
Subaru
Model:
Impreza
Body type:
Hatchback
Exterior color:
Crystal White Pearl
Interior color:
Black
Transmission:
Continuously Variable Transmission
Mileage:
136,066
Stock #:
K3708264
VIN:
4S3GTAM66K3708264
Crystal White Pearl 2019 Subaru Impreza Hatchback  Continuously Variable Transmission
New arrival

 

2019 Subaru Impreza

2.0i Sport Hatchback AWD with EyeSight Package

136,066 mi

Hopkins, MN
5 mi away
Great Deal

$11,845

Year:
2025
Make:
Subaru
Model:
Ascent
Body type:
SUV / Crossover
Doors:
4 doors
Drivetrain:
All-Wheel Drive
Engine:
260 hp 2.4L H4
Exterior color:
Crystal White Pearl
Combined gas mileage:
23 MPG
Fuel type:
Gasoline
Interior color:
Black
Transmission:
Continuously Variable Transmission
Mileage:
16,908
Stock #:
S3424438
VIN:
4S4WMAAD7S3424438
Crystal White Pearl 2025 Subaru Ascent SUV / Crossover All-Wheel Drive Continuously Variable Transmission
Price drop

-$1,373

 

2025 Subaru Ascent

Premium 8-Passenger AWD

16,908 mi

Brooklyn Park, MN
12 mi away
Great Deal
Manufacturer certified

$31,600

$30,227

Year:
2024
Make:
Subaru
Model:
Crosstrek
Body type:
SUV / Crossover
Doors:
4 doors
Drivetrain:
All-Wheel Drive
Engine:
182 hp 2.5L H4
Exterior color:
Silver
Combined gas mileage:
27 MPG
Fuel type:
Gasoline
Interior color:
Black
Transmission:
Continuously Variable Transmission
Mileage:
12,301
Stock #:
25BJ0014P
VIN:
4S4GUHT65R3821927
Silver 2024 Subaru Crosstrek SUV / Crossover All-Wheel Drive Continuously Variable Transmission
Price drop

-$601

 

2024 Subaru Crosstrek

Wilderness AWD

12,301 mi

South Saint Paul, MN
26 mi away
Good Deal

$28,949

$28,348

Page 1 of 88

A better way to discover your best deal

Let us help you find a car you’ll love.

CarGurus Footer